In this Ask A Dev, Web Developer DJ Karasek gives developers a better idea of what makes Facebook React stand out from the front-end framework crowd (aside from its name).

For starters, React allows you to combine CSS, Java, and other code docs into one file using JSX, but that's not all. DJ also talks about React’s virtual DOM, and how it saves time by allowing developers to render individual components with a state change instead of the entire site. He’ll also discuss React’s native capabilities, which are so popular, other framework teams are actually meeting with the React team to figure out how to implement it into their frameworks.
